Sources minérales de Sirab, located near the Nakhchivan city in Azerbaijan's exclave territory, are naturally carbonated bicarbonate springs whose refreshing, effervescent water is bottled and distributed widely across the region. Sirab's carbogazeous mineral water is comparable in character to famous European sparkling mineral waters and has been scientifically studied for its digestive and tonic properties. The springs emerge from a geologically complex zone of the Nakhchivan tectonic depression, and Sirab water is deeply embedded in the daily life and culinary culture of Azerbaijan's southwestern exclave.

Insider tip — The Sirab mineral springs in Nakhchivan are celebrated in Azerbaijan as among the finest naturally carbonated bicarbonate waters in the South Caucasus, effervescing cold at 18°C from the volcanic terrain of this isolated exclave. The water is prized for drinking cures for digestive and metabolic conditions and is bottled commercially under the Sirab brand. The surrounding landscape of semi-arid hills and ancient Silk Road ruins underscores the site's long history of human use. The cool temperature makes Sirab more of a drinking spring than a bathing experience, best visited alongside a tour of Nakhchivan's remarkable hilltop fortresses.
